Subject: Schema registry handover

Hi Petra,

Quick handover on the Moswick event schema registry before your review. All event producers validate against it at publish time; rejected payloads land in a quarantine topic. Write access is limited to the platform role, everyone else reads. Audit log covers every schema change. The registry's backing database connects via the string below.

Cheers, Anselm

primary connection of kahof-kagep = mssql://belath_svc:3uqY4g6LHG5Nyi@db-d0ba.ferralabs.corp:5432/rusdor

Subject: Velmora unit sale — heads up

Team,

Quick note before the all-hands: we've signed a letter of intent to sell the Velmora accessories unit to Kestrel Ridge Holdings. Nothing changes for current pipeline — keep closing as usual, and don't speculate with customers. Mira Odell will field questions at Thursday's sync. Legal expects diligence to wrap by end of quarter. Please treat this as sensitive until the public announcement. The note below covers what comes next.

confidential, baweg-bahaf: Brivanax Logistics is in early talks to buy Sordorek Freight for about $52.6 million. The Briion launch date is January 22, and nothing goes to the press before then.

Action item from the Wrenhall Gallery audio-guide postmortem: the TourStream app cached stale exhibit manifests after the midnight sync job failed silently, leaving visitors with mismatched narration for three hours. Please review the retry wrapper in the manifest fetcher carefully — it swallows timeout exceptions and logs them at debug level only, which is why nothing alerted. We want the fix to raise on the third failure and page on-call. The full incident timeline and logs are posted on the internal wiki page below.

wiki page, yajof-tafof: https://confluence.lumiclabs.internal/display/projects/projects/projects

Quotas for the Verifex validator plugin system are enforced at load time and per invocation. Plugins exceeding the execution or memory ceilings are suspended until the next release train, so confirm vendor plugins comply before sign-off. The current enforced limits, unchanged since the Halvern release, are defined below.

tuning constants:
QUOTAS = {
    "druwyn": 5,
    "holix": 5,
    "zorath": 5,
    "holwyn": 10,
}